Tian Chua: Supension of ISA 7' unlawful
Keadilan vice-president Tian Chua, who was released from Kamunting Detention Camp a month ago, has expressed empathy with seven students charged with illegal assembly while protesting the detention of reformasi activists under the Internal Security Act (ISA) in June 2001.
The ' ISA 7 ', as the group has been dubbed, were arrested and charged for demonstrating outside the National Mosque in Kuala Lumpur. They were subsequently suspended by their universities.
The seven are Rafzan Ramli, Helman Sanudin, Khairul Amal Mahmood, Ahmad Kamal Abdul Hamid, Wan Sanusi Wan Mohd Noor, Nik Noorhafizi Nik Ismail and Zulkifli Idris.
